The struggles of Mauro Ranallo and his bipolar disorder are widely documented, but now they have been released in a documentary on Showtime, the network where the NXT broadcaster announces premier boxing matches.

Suffering from mental illness myself, I find it important that people are aware of the issues out there. I have suffered from agoraphobia for years and am on the slow road to recovery. Still, despite my problems, bipolar disorder is a whole lot harder to live with. A lot of people do not know much about it. So, a documentary surrounding a well-known public figure is certainly a good thing.

Bipolar Rock ‘n Roller Trailer

The documentary follows Mauro Ranallo and his struggles with being bi-polar and in the public eye. It is set the premiere on Friday, May 25th at 9 pm EST during Mental Health Awareness Month. Here is the trailer for the upcoming documentary:

How This Trailer Has Impacted Me

Honestly, the trailer had an impact on me. When Ranallo said “quit being a wussy”, “go out, get some fresh air”, those are the things people tell me. If you are not familiar with agoraphobia, it is a mental health problem that causes me to have an irrational fear of going outside. When I head to the supermarket, for example, I get terrible panic attacks. I avoided going out for years and even became housebound at one point. Even though I can now go to a store, I still have intense fear every time I go outside.

People who do not suffer from a mental health problem can never understand what it is like. Sorry, you just cannot grasp it. Other sufferers will probably recognize statements such as “get over it” or “quit being such a wuss”, contrary to those who do not. Mental health problems must be understood and this documentary is certainly the first step to generating more understanding and acceptance among non-sufferers. I will certainly watch. Maybe one day… People will stop telling us to “stop being a wuss”.
